importance Of precious materials In oil casing
The Oil and gas industry is a cornerstone of the global economy, providing energy that powers industries, homes, and transportation systems. within this sector, the integrity and reliability of oil casing are paramount, as they serve as the protective barrier between the wellbore and the surrounding geological formations. The materials used in oil casing must withstand extreme conditions, including high pressures, corrosive environments, and significant temperature variations. Consequently, the importance of precious materials in oil casing cannot be overstated, as they play a critical role in ensuring the safety, efficiency, and longevity of oil extraction operations.
Precious materials, such as high-grade alloys and specialized coatings, are increasingly being utilized in the manufacturing of oil casing. these materials are selected for their unique properties, which include exceptional strength, resistance to corrosion, and durability under extreme conditions. For instance, the use of stainless steel, which contains chromium, enhances the resistance of casing to corrosive substances often found in oil reservoirs. This is particularly important in offshore drilling operations, where exposure to seawater and other harsh environmental factors can lead to r APId degradation of standard materials. By incorporating precious materials into the design of oil casing, operators can significantly reduce the risk of failure, thereby safeguarding both personnel and the environment.
Moreover, the economic implications of using precious materials in oil casing are profound. While the initial investment in high-quality materials may be higher than that of conventional options, the long-term benefits often outweigh these costs. Enhanced durability leads to fewer Maintenance requirements and reduced downtime, which translates into increased productivity and profitability for oil Companies. Additionally, the use of advanced materials can extend the lifespan of the casing, allowing for more efficient resource extraction over time. This is particularly relevant in an era where the demand for oil continues to rise, necessitating the exploration of more challenging and remote locations.
In addition to their physical properties, precious materials also contribute to the overall sustainability of oil extraction processes. As the industry faces increasing scrutiny regarding its environmental impact, the adoption of materials that minimize Leakage and contamination becomes essential. For example, advanced coatings that provide additional protection against corrosion can help prevent the release of harmful substances into the surrounding ecosystem. This not only aligns with regulatory requirements but also enhances the industry’s reputation as it strives to adopt more responsible practices.
